Best thing to do is have it recharged. If its a newer model then it uses R134A and you can buy that in any local parts store. If you charge it and the compressor doesnt kick on then it needs a new compressor most likely. Go the cheap route first and try recharging it.
The pressure switch can go bad in these systems.If adding freon doesn't help,you can use a jumper wire to force the compressor to operate.I don't know which connection to jump however,sorry.
